American Council of the Blind of Maryland 2022 Annual Conference and Convention February 25-26, 2022 A mighty little state with a wealth of history and resources Panel: Mobility and beyond MaryBeth Cleveland, certified orientation and mobility specialist, A to B and Back, Derwood, MD, [email protected] and Cecelia Rose, certified orientation and mobility specialist, [email protected] Diane Ducharme, Community Outreach, The Low Vision Shop, Baltimore MD, [email protected] Panel: recreation Hughes, Robyn, Pikesville, MD, [email protected], adaptive kayaking, Braille trails in MA and MD, Horseback riding and Eric Phifer, Vice President, Outa Sight Dragon Boat team, [email protected] Panel: employment, education and rehabilitation Naomi Soule, Retired District Supervisor for Rehabilitation Services, Missouri" [email protected] and Toni March, Director, Division of Rehabilitation Services, Office of Blindness and Vision Services, Baltimore, MD, [email protected] Conchita Hernandez, Statewide Blind and Low Vision Specialist, Maryland State Department of Education, Baltimore, MD, [email protected] Find out more at https://acb-events.pinecast.co
